Hi 8mm to PC to DVD

So i have a lot of film of my son playing football on my Sony Hi 8mm tapes and want to know how to transfer them to my PC so i can edit them and burn them to a DVD.
the camera has the usual 3 plug 1 video and 2 audio plugs. It also has a Super video plug and i know if i use this i won't get any audio.
Is there an adapter i can get to transfer them to my PC?

Tv capture card. Basically gives you red/white/yellow inputs/s-video input for your pc. There are several internal cards for desktops or Usb for laptops/desktops. You'll need a good amount of hard drive space. Then some sort of software to edit it up. Windows Movie Maker for simple stuff or something like adobe premiere for higher end editing.
